How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Nevada?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Nevada Studio Apartments | $1,387 | $1,129 | $3,756 |
Nevada 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,786 | $999 | $5,141 |
Nevada 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,041 | $994 | $8,599 |
Nevada 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,590 | $1,225 | $10,000+ |
Nevada 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,698 | $2,222 | $4,689 |

Frequently Asked Questions about New Nevada Apartments
What is the Cheapest New apartment in Nevada?
Currently the most affordable New Apartment in Nevada is at Fountainview at Farmersville listed at $999.
How much is the average rent for a New Nevada Apartment?
The average rent for a New Apartment in Nevada is $2,661.
What is the largest New Nevada Apartment for rent?
Today's New apartment with the most square footage in Nevada is a 2,722 square feet unit starting from $1,973 at Crestridge Meadows.
What is the average size for Nevada New Apartments for rent?
The average size for a New rental in Nevada is currently at 723 sq ft.
